Default Re: does anybody know how to get rid of the maf sensor?

that's right barman, if you use the bigger mass air flow housing it will run richer to compensate for the extra air so with an safc you could lean out the mixture and get some more power. Only real way to do the tuning is on a dyno though with a a/f ratio gauge or better yet a wideband o2 sensor.
